Question 5
5. In 2014, a wealthy young couple, the spouses Tan, moved by the spirit of generosity and love for their hometown in Siquijor, decided to donate a one-hectare lot in favor of the province of Siquijor. The Deed of Donation pertinently provides:
“The herein DONORS hereby voluntarily and freely give, transfer and convey, by way of unconditional donation, unto said DONEE, all of the rights, title and interest which the aforesaid DONORS have or which pertain to them and which they owned exclusively in the above-described real property over a one hectare portion of the same, solely for hospital site only and for no other purpose, where a provincial government hospital shall be constructed.”
The donation was recorded in the Registry of Deeds, and a certificate of title to the property was transferred to the province of Siquijor. In accordance with the Deed of Donation, the construction of a hospital building was started in the following year.
However, for reasons unknown, only the foundation of the hospital building has, to this day, been completed.
Do the spouses Tan have valid grounds to revoke the donation? Explain briefly. (5 points)
